Las Vegas Golden Knights Slip in Tight Road Loss to Blues
The Las Vegas Golden Knights came up just short today, falling 4–3 to the St. Louis Blues in a tightly contested matchup that featured playoff level intensity. Vegas battled throughout and generated quality scoring chances, but defensive lapses at key moments allowed St. Louis to capitalize just enough thanks to their late goal in the third to hold the edge. Despite a strong outing, the Knights couldn’t tie things back up after the sub 2 minute remaining goal, making this a frustrating loss against a Western Conference foe as the standings continue to tighten.
